**Mgmt Meeting Minutes — Retiring the Brightline Range**

Quick recap for sales leads at Fenholt Supplies: we agreed to retire the Brightline fixture range by year-end. Remaining stock moves to clearance pricing next month, and accounts on standing orders get migrated to the Lumetta range. Trade-in incentives were approved in principle. The confidential note on next steps sits just below.

board note of bajof-bajeg: The pricing group signed off on a budget of $13.4 million for Project Sildor. The renewal with Lamixek Holdings closes at $48.9 million a year, 49 percent above the last contract.

Subject: Northern Region Sales Review — quick heads-up

Hi all,

Thanks for pulling the branch numbers together so fast. Overall the Harwick and Dunlea branches beat target, while Ostermoor slipped about 6% — mostly the delayed Fenwick Pro launch. We'll walk through the details on Thursday's call, so branch managers, please have your pipeline notes ready. Nothing alarming, but a few trends worth discussing in person. Before the call, please read the plan summary that follows.

confidential, yajog-tageg: The southern region missed its Zorius quota by 3.5 percent last quarter. Quenethek Systems plans to raise the Lamwyn list price by 65.7 percent in March. The steering committee signed off on a budget of $145.3 million for Project Giliel. The renewal with Praionox Freight closes at $236.1 million a year, 44.6 percent below the last contract.

### Step 6: Vendor the Fonts

Okay, font time. Pull the licensed typefaces from the Quillbarn vault and drop them into `assets/vendor/fonts/` — don't fetch them at build time, the vault rate-limits and your release will stall. Run `make fontcheck` to confirm the license manifests match. Once that's green, the bundle needs to be signed before the CDN push, same as every other vendored asset. Sign the font bundle with the key below.

deploy key for kahof-tadup: bky4_rRMZ